Hi Philip,
I looks as if you need to add fo:table-column for each column in your table.
You will probably also want to define the column-number and column width for
each fo:table-column to give the desired results.

That should fix the problem.

Hi All,

I am trying to build a dynamic table in FO, but having little luck. I keep
receiving the following error:

[error]java.lang.ArrayIndexOutofBoundsException: -2


Here is my XML:

<table>
	<tbody>
		<tr>
			<td>Cell 1</td>
			<td>Cell 2</td>
			<td>Cell 3</td>
		</tr>
		<tr>
			<td>test 1</td>
			<td>test 2</td>
			<td>test 3</td>
		</tr>
		<tr>
			<td>cell 1</td>
			<td>cell 2</td>
			<td>cell 3</td>
		</tr>
	</tbody>
</table>


I am using the Apache FOP processor
Here is my XSLT:

<xsl:template match="table">
	<fo:block>
		<xsl:for-each select="tbody">
			<fo:table>
				<fo:table-body>
					<xsl:for-each select="tr">
						<fo:table-row>
							<xsl:for-each
select="td">
	
<fo:table-cell>
	
<fo:block>
	
<xsl:value-of select="."/>
	
</fo:block>
	
</fo:table-cell>
							</xsl:for-each>
						</fo:table-row>
					</xsl:for-each>
				</fo:table-body>
			</fo:table>
		</xsl:for-each>
	</fo:block>
</xsl:template>
